Output 98cd00a6bcb3f7c2042fd1391419ccfecb1795d049a664b4219cfb11beac4d3d:1

value
64000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e6a02753d829f5907f317f93e75a12e37b7283 OP_EQUAL
address
3MC28Yvf5Uh7A15o1AeiZvHYq3WcdyxPZz
transaction
98cd00a6bcb3f7c2042fd1391419ccfecb1795d049a664b4219cfb11beac4d3d
confirmations
236893
spent
true